Bug#621893: evince-gtk: search does not work when search phrase crosses line-break

Arthur Marsh arthur.marsh at internode.on.net
Sat Apr 9 14:59:48 UTC 2011


Package: evince-gtk
Version: 2.30.3-3
Severity: normal


I tried to search for a phrase in a PDF document, and discovered that 
evince-gtk did not find the phrase where it was split over two lines.

The actual document was:

http://www.comlaw.gov.au/Details/F2009L04720/d81b310e-f6da-4aa8-adec-4d29e92e3ace

referenced from: 

http://www.comlaw.gov.au/Details/F2009L04720/Download

The search phrase "Integrated Public Number Database" is split across a line
around page 20 of the document, and not found in that location by evince-gtk.

mupdf found the phrase that was split over two lines.

It appears that the line break was not in the original PDF, but only in
evince-gtk's rendering of it.

-- System Information:
Debian Release: wheezy/sid
  APT prefers unstable
  APT policy: (500, 'unstable'), (500, 'testing'), (500, 'stable'), (1, 'experimental')
Architecture: i386 (i686)

Kernel: Linux 2.6.38.2 (SMP w/1 CPU core)
Locale: LANG=en_AU.UTF-8, LC_CTYPE=en_AU.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/bash

Versions of packages evince-gtk depends on:
ii  evince-common           2.30.3-3         Document (PostScript, PDF) viewer 
ii  gnome-icon-theme        2.30.3-2         GNOME Desktop icon theme
ii  libatk1.0-0             1.32.0-3         The ATK accessibility toolkit
ii  libc6                   2.11.2-11        Embedded GNU C Library: Shared lib
ii  libcairo2               1.10.2-6         The Cairo 2D vector graphics libra
ii  libevince2              2.30.3-3         Document (PostScript, PDF) renderi
ii  libfontconfig1          2.8.0-2.1        generic font configuration library
ii  libfreetype6            2.4.4-1          FreeType 2 font engine, shared lib
ii  libglib2.0-0            2.28.4-1         The GLib library of C routines
ii  libgtk2.0-0             2.24.3-1         The GTK+ graphical user interface 
ii  libice6                 2:1.0.7-1        X11 Inter-Client Exchange library
ii  libpango1.0-0           1.28.3-6         Layout and rendering of internatio
ii  libsm6                  2:1.2.0-1        X11 Session Management library
ii  libx11-6                2:1.4.3-1        X11 client-side library
ii  libxml2                 2.7.8.dfsg-2     GNOME XML library
ii  shared-mime-info        0.90-1           FreeDesktop.org shared MIME databa
ii  zlib1g                  1:1.2.3.4.dfsg-3 compression library - runtime

Versions of packages evince-gtk recommends:
ii  dbus-x11                      1.4.6-1    simple interprocess messaging syst

Versions of packages evince-gtk suggests:
ii  gvfs                          1.6.4-3    userspace virtual filesystem - ser
pn  nautilus                      <none>     (no description available)
ii  poppler-data                  0.4.4-1    Encoding data for the poppler PDF 
pn  unrar                         <none>     (no description available)

-- debconf-show failed





More information about the pkg-gnome-maintainers mailing list